Hoover Angus Farm:

Tonight we pay tribute to Hoover Dam, as he was laid to rest today at ORIgen. Hoover Dam was 11 1/2 years of age, and spent most of his life at ORIgen, where he was the #1 all-time semen sales bull as well as the #1 semen production bull. Hoover Dam's influence has been felt on at least four continents, as well as widespread in the U.S. Roughly one quarter million units of his semen have been sold.
Hoover Dam was bred, born, and raised at Hoover Angus, as was his dam. This Erica cow family at Hoover Angus has put a total of 8 bulls in the following AI studs: ORIgen, Alta Genetics, Select Sires, ABS, Accelerated Genetics, and CRV-USA.
Hoover Dam's hallmark traits were producing superior uddered, highly productive females, improving dispositions, and having an optimum combination of calving ease, muscle, and carcass qualities.
